About Anni Grove

Anni Grove is a scholar working on Surgery,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Reproductive Medicine and Genetics, having authored 37 papers that have together received 670 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Gestational Trophoblastic Disease Studies (8 papers), Ovarian cancer diagnosis and treatment (6 papers), Occupational and environmental lung diseases (4 papers), Prenatal Screening and Diagnostics (4 papers), Sarcoma Diagnosis and Treatment (3 papers), Urologic and reproductive health conditions (2 papers), Venous Thromboembolism Diagnosis and Management (2 papers) and Renal and related cancers (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Reproductive Medicine (179 citations), Obstetrics and Gynecology (57 citations), Internal Medicine (25 citations), Pathology and Forensic Medicine (88 citations) and Dermatology (41 citations). Anni Grove has collaborated with scholars based in Denmark, United States and Sweden. Frequent co-authors include Marianne Waldstrøm, Mogens Vyberg, Claus Bisgaard, G. F. Rabotti, A Donna, Marianne Lidang Jensen, Estrid Stæhr Hansen, Aage Knudsen, Anna Tolf and Bjørn I. Bertelsen. Their work appears in journals such as Acta Obstetricia Et Gynecologica Scandinavica, Apmis, Histopathology, Archiv für Pathologische Anatomie und Physiologie und für Klinische Medicin and Gynecologic Oncology.
